Long: From Personal Experience

by Chris Tachibana | May 3, 2014

ingres-harvey-sisters-portrait-1804Priscilla Long shares the story of her late sister while explaining the science of schizophrenia in The American Scholar. Genetics, inflammation, and infectious disease provide partial answers to Priscilla’s questions about the disease. Priscilla also shares a beautiful, nostalgic picture of her sister Susanne.
